Global Maritime Information Market size was valued at USD 2.6 Billion in 2023 and is poised to grow from USD 2.8 Billion in 2024 to USD 5.0 Bill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 8.6% during the forecast period (2025-2032).
The global maritime information market is experiencing notable growth, driven by increasing demands for safety, regulatory compliance, and operational efficiency. As global trade expands, accurate route monitoring and risk assessment are becoming essential for adherence to international maritime standards. Companies are leveraging advanced data analytics to optimize shipping routes, improve fleet efficiency, and reduce fuel consumption. The integration of cutting-edge technologies such as real-time vessel tracking and predictive analytics enhances decision-making capabilities while lowering operating costs. However, challenges such as high implementation costs and data privacy concerns persist. With a rising emphasis on transparency and accountability, investments in integrated maritime platforms are on the rise, supported by collaborations between maritime firms and tech companies, facilitating innovation in the maritime sector.

Driver of the Global Maritime Information Market
Growing concerns about maritime safety, security, and environmental preservation are significant catalysts for the global maritime information market. Issues such as piracy, illegal fishing, and other maritime events underscore the necessity for secure maritime information systems. These systems offer real-time tracking, monitoring, and analytics, facilitating proactive risk management and ensuring the safety of vessels, crews, and cargo. Additionally, increasing regulatory pressures and mandatory reporting practices encourage the adoption of comprehensive maritime information solutions, further driving the demand for compliance and transparency within the industry. This overall landscape highlights the critical role played by maritime information technologies in enhancing safety and security across global waters.
Restraints in the Global Maritime Information Market
The Global Maritime Information market faces significant challenges due to the digital transformation of the maritime sector, which has heightened vulnerability to cybersecurity threats and data breaches. Information systems within this industry gather and share substantial amounts of sensitive data, such as vessel locations, cargo details, and navigation routes, making them prime targets for hackers and unauthorized access. Cyberattacks on port operations or navigation systems pose serious risks, including financial losses, operational interruptions, and threats to national security. Moreover, the reliance on interconnected systems amplifies the need for robust cybersecurity measures. However, the lack of standardized practices and limited investment in cybersecurity from smaller entities represent major obstacles to market growth.
Market Trends of the Global Maritime Information Market
The Global Maritime Information market is witnessing a significant upward trend driven by increasing government investments in advanced maritime information solutions. With the rise in illegal fishing, piracy, smuggling, and territorial disputes, the demand for robust maritime domain awareness (MDA) platforms is surging. These platforms utilize an array of technologies, including radar systems, satellite imagery, coastal surveillance, and vessel behavior analytics, to offer comprehensive situational awareness. Particularly in high-risk regions such as the Gulf of Aden and the South China Sea, the need for integrated maritime systems is critical for enhancing national security and protecting commercial assets. This growing market trend is pivotal in fortifying naval, coast guard, and port authority operations globally.
